October 2026
A self reliant two day mountain marathon in Talnotry, Scotland with map and compass navigation, team camping and multiple course options from Elite to Short Score.
A 10 km trail race from Auchterarder into the Ochil Hills with forest trails, stream crossings and a route shaped like a chilli pepper. Online entry, 16+ age limit, goody bag with snood and medal, prizes for finishers and costumes.
Trail half marathon around Dalmeny Estate and Cammo Nature Reserve with wooded trails, riverside paths, under 1000 ft total ascent, chip timing and a finisher medal.
November 2026
A mixed terrain trail festival at Tentsmuir Forest near Tayport offering a half marathon, 10 km, 5 km, junior 5 km and a 1.2 km family fun run with marshalled, signposted routes and charitable proceeds for the Tayport Community Trust.
A multi terrain 10 km race on 1 November 2026 with a reversed route featuring road and trail sections, views over Loch Tulla and a finishing descent across the Bridge of Orchy. Entries are limited and the event uses chip timing.
A 50 km trail ultramarathon from Grantown-on-Spey to Forres that follows the old Highland Railway line, reaches Dava summit, and passes woodland, moorland and historic sites.
Knockfarrel Hill Race on 7 November 2026 is an 8 km hill race with 300 m of climb, with day-of-event registration at Strathpeffer Community Centre replacing the previous Shinty Pavilion location.
A six-hour nocturnal ultra on the John Muir Way where runners cover as many 5 km off road loops as possible, solo or in teams of up to three, with a tented base and support.
Short Course Cross Country Championships at Kirkcaldy High School on 7 November 2026. ProTay provides race pack fulfilment and timing while working with scottishathletics.
A roughly 33 mile footrace in Perthshire from Killin to Strathyre along parts of cycle route No 7 and the Rob Roy Way, with midrace checkpoints, a drop-bag at Strathyre and mandatory kit for November Highland conditions.
Inaugural Kilpatrick Hills half marathon on 14 November 2026 featuring single-track trails and forestry roads, limited to 50 places and listed as closed.
A multi-terrain ultra around the Tweed Valley based at Glentress Peel Visitor Centre in mid-November. Two route options, 65 km and 50 km, follow forest trails, riverside paths and open moorland with marked routes and aid stations.
A single 5 km race at Linn Park on 15 November 2026, part of the South By Five series across six parks. Entry is free with a required minimum donation to the Acorn Trails Community Fund.
An 8 hour loop event at Culbin Forest where runners complete 4.366 mile laps tracked by wrist tags, aiming for half, full or ultra marathon distances.
Trail runs at Hermitage of Braid and Blackford Hill with 10 km, 5 km and a 1.2 km festive fun run supporting a local school and the reserve.
A solo 69 km trail run from Glamis Castle to Scone Palace with a marked route, checkpoints, GPS tracking and chip timing. Finishers receive a medal and meal voucher; entries for 2026 are open.
A single-entry 5 km race at Rouken Glen on 29 November 2026, part of the South By Five six-park series. Entry is free but places are limited and a mandatory donation to the Acorn Trails Community Fund applies.
December 2026
Festive trail runs at Glamis Castle with 1 mile family, 5 and 10 mile options, chip timing, on-site parking and canicross-friendly races.
Multiple point to point races along the West Lothian Shale Trail, from 9K to a GPS tracked 50K, plus a 3 person relay. The event supports Smalls for All and features marked routes, checkpoints and chip timing.
Festive 5k at Chatelherault Country Park on 6 December 2026 with a Santa costume and medal included; open to ages five and up, family tickets available.
